Humberto Sato
Humberto Sato (1940-2018) was a renowned Peruvian chef and founder of Costanera 700, a celebrated restaurant in Lima known for its Nikkei cuisine, which blends traditional Peruvian and Japanese flavors. His culinary vision emphasized authenticity and tradition, with signature dishes like the famous cebiche de la paz, which played a notable role in diplomatic history. Sato's legacy continues through his family's commitment to preserving the restaurant's identity while subtly incorporating modern culinary techniques.
